The nature of the chemical bond in experimentally known zinc-rich transition metal compounds M(ZnR) (n = 8-12) is investigated. at first glance these molecules appear to be endohedral clusters but the bonding analyses show that the stability of the molecules is caused by large radial interactions which are typical for coordination compounds.
